Reschedule Public Hearing Date for Extension of <br />Development Moratorium Ordinance <br />Because the public hearing notice was not published, City <br />Administrator Overby suggested rescheduling the Public Hearing <br />date for the extension of the Development Moratorium Ordinance to <br />Monday, Spetember 29, 1986 at 7:30 p.m. at the Joint Session of <br />the Planning Commission and City Council. <br />M/S/P Armstrong/Dunn - to schedule the public hearing for the <br />extension of the Development Moratorium Ordinance for Monday, <br />September 29, 1986 at 7:30 p.m. at the Joint session of the City <br />Council and Planning Commission. (Motion carried 4-0). <br />Repair or Replacement of Street Sander Unit <br />Maintenance Foreman Dan Olinger reported that one of the two <br />sander units they use for road shoulder work and winter sanding <br />has developed mechanical problems. One main shaft has broken, and <br />one shaft is bent beyond repair. Olinger felt that both shafts, <br />all the bearings, drive chain and one sprocket would have to be <br />replaced. A repair estimate from Al's Welding and Repairs was <br />$1,029.47. A replacement estimate for a new sander unit (without <br />controls) was $1,500.00. The unit has probably reached beyond the <br />halfway point in its life expectancy. Finance Director Banister <br />confirmed that enough money remains in the Maintenance budget to <br />cover either repair or replacement of this unit. <br />M/S/P Dunn/Mazzara - to approve purchasing a new sander unit <br />(without controls) for $1,500. (motion carried 4-0). <br />D. Process for Renewal of Administrator's Contract <br />The Contract between the City of Lake Elmo and the City <br />Administrator expires on September 30, 1986. City Administrator <br />Overby recommends extending the provisions of the current contract <br />until December 31, 1986. This extension would serve two purposes; <br />it would put the starting date on January 1st, which would be <br />consistent with the City's agreements with the various <br />consultants; also, it would provide some time to schedule an <br />evaluation session between the City Administrator and the City <br />Council. Armstrong explained that this amendment to the contract <br />should be in writing. <br />M/S/P Armstrong/Dunn - to accept City Administrator Overby's <br />recommendation to extend the provisions of the current contract <br />until December 31, 1986.
